Something about Richie...

I was born and raised in Brooklyn, New York until the age of fifteen. As my Father's business grew, we moved out to Long Island, New York for "The Better Life".

When I became seventeen I began College at The University of Hartford in Connecticut.

From there I began my career back in New York City in The Garment Center at a Women's Apparel Manufacturing Company. I was involved in both Design and Sales. I quickly learned to build relationships and hone my sales skills. I became partners in two companies in which I was President in CET Fashions, Inc. and Vice President in Cue Fashions, Inc. The sales between both companies grew over the years to about 35 million dollars. We sold to major Chain and Department Stores nationwide.

In 1996 I also started a Website Company called Eons Ahead, Inc., developing Websites for New York based companies. Through Eons Ahead, I was able to develop my marketing skills.

In 1998, after 28 years in the same business I sold my shares in the Apparel Companies and sold The Web Developing Company as well. My family and I decided to make a major change in our lives. We relocated to Ahwatukee in Phoenix, Arizona. We relocated after visiting close friends who moved there before. The first thing that won us over was the Beauty of Arizona. Then it was the climate. We had enough of the cold and wet weather that is characteristic of the Northeast. In New York, if you see the Sun once a week that was good. Now in Arizona it is the opposite.

Buying a home here was unbelievable. Homes here are about half or a third of the price of a similar home back in New York. And the property taxes here in Arizona are about One percent of the sales price. It made sense to make the move, I just needed to find out what will I do next for a career.

My wife Mary Ann went to Culinary School back in New York and became a Chef. She decided that she would like to open a small restaurant where we now live in Ahwatukee. We took over an existing one, beyond bagels, and made it very successful in the three and a half years we are here. In that time, I began once again to develop solid relationships with our customers. It was now time to start my new career selling Residential Real Estate specializing in the Ahwatukee, Chandler, and Tempe areas.
